With six days before the MLB trade deadline, the New York Mets have landed on the board by trading for relief pitcher Gregory Soto from the Baltimore Orioles on Friday, SNY's Andy Martinio reported. ESPN's Jeff Passan confirmed the news.
The Orioles receive minor-league pitchers Wellington Aracena and Cameron Foster in return for Soto, who is a pending free agent.
